+ 8x8 font with full Uni2 character set (suitable for console)

This commit is contained in:
Vovanium 2022-04-24 21:32:21 +03:00
parent 18b90c849b
commit 47632f568c
3 changed files with 8750 additions and 5 deletions

View File

@ -17,12 +17,13 @@ check-coverage-sans :
check-coverage-mono :
awk -f tools/check-coverage.awk mono/salut-mono*.bdf
.PHONY: psf
.PHONY: consolefonts
psf : build/consolefonts/Uni2-Salut16.psf
psf : build/consolefonts/Uni2-Salut16b.psf
consolefonts : build/consolefonts/Uni2-Salut08w.psf
consolefonts : build/consolefonts/Uni2-Salut16.psf
consolefonts : build/consolefonts/Uni2-Salut16b.psf
build/consolefonts/Uni2-Salut16.psf : build/consolefonts/Uni2-Salut%.psf : mono/salut-mono%.bdf
build/consolefonts/Uni2-Salut%.psf : mono/salut-mono%.bdf
mkdir -p $(@D)
bdf2psf $< /usr/share/bdf2psf/standard.equivalents /usr/share/bdf2psf/fontsets/Uni2.512 512 $@

View File

@ -30,7 +30,7 @@ Original inctruction: https://fedoraproject.org/wiki/BitmapFontConversion
16x8 font can be installed in Linux console.
First, convert BDF to PSF (bdf2psf utility needed for this).
`make psf` command will do conversion for you.
`make consolefonts` command will do conversion for you.
Then, copy psf fonts from build/consolefonts to /usr/consolefonts or whereever
your distribution keeps .psf/.psf.gz files.
Finally use console-setup or similarly named service to configure

8744
mono/salut-mono08w.bdf Normal file

File diff suppressed because it is too large Load Diff